What is the slope of the line that passes through (0,5) and (10,0)?

Respuesta :

mathstudent55
mathstudent55 mathstudent55
  • 12-07-2022

Answer:

-1/2

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ex] m = \dfrac{y_2 - y_1}{x_2 - x_1} [/tex]

[tex]m = \dfrac{0 - 5}{10 - 0} = \dfrac{-5}{10} = -\dfrac{1}{2}[/tex]

Answer: slope = -1/2
